Unraveling the Art of Pure Kanjivaram Sarees
Kanjivaram sarees represent a rich heritage, demanding careful study to truly recognize their allure. The making is remarkably complex, beginning with meticulous picking of superior silk yarns . Classic motifs, often drawn from temple structures and nature, are carefully woven, employing a specific pit weaving device . Key aspects include the contrast boundaries, the heavy end piece , and the nuanced interplay of color . Genuine Kanjivaram sarees are a testament to the skill of the craftspeople who dedicate generations to this legacy craft.

The Kanjivaram Silk vs. The Kanchipuram Silk: Exploring the Distinctions
While frequently used , "Kanjivaram" and "Kanchipuram" often cause confusion. Kanjivaram denotes a specific type of silk saree originating from Kanchipuram, a district in Tamil Nadu, India . Essentially, Kanjivaram Handwoven Kanchipuram Sarees is a subset *within* the broader Kanchipuram silk weaving tradition . Historically , all Kanjivaram sarees *were* woven in Kanchipuram, but today, weavers have migrated and established studios in other locations , most notably Chennai. Consequently, a saree labelled "Kanjivaram" should adhere to specific weaving methods and motifs characteristic of the original Kanjivaram art .
- This Kanjivaram style often features contrasting colors and bold temple motifs.
- Kanchipuram silk, however, can encompass a wider range of patterns not exclusively bound by the strict guidelines of the Kanjivaram design .
